Photographer Captures The Special Bond Between Grandparents And Grandchildren

April 8, 2017

Photographer Ivette Ivens was born in Radviliskis, Lithuania. She is currently living near Chicago with her husband, Todd, and her two sons.

Luckily for Ivens, her parents are able to spend three months with the family every year. On their most recent trip, she decided to use that time together to create a timeless photo series called "Generations," celebrating the relationship her two young sons have with their grandparents.
